CIO in Healthcare and Biotecha year ago
You need to have your enterprise architecture defined, socialised and embedded as part of decision making criteria with all your top level stakeholders well before you get into discussions around how to manage ‘urgent’ business demands. If its not seen to produce value in less urgent demands its not going to work when there is a temptation to skip steps because or urgency. Your enterprise architecture principles should be pragmatic not academic so its flexible enough to deal with urgent business demands as well as day to day ones.
